Spatial Design 3.0 forms a new dialogue between the artist and design artefacts, lens-based practice and the entanglements of contemporary critical theory. The artist was invited to exhibit at the Peninsula Art Gallery in Plymouth, UK at the Envelop Exhibition as part of the UK Festival of Design 2015. The artwork involves wire, photography, printing, mark making, typography and patterns negotiated and frozen within spatial arrangements. These elements are manipulated as a means to engage the traditional tools and instruments of art and design methodology in contemporary practice. The work was published and internationally distributed in the accompanying catalogue.
